What You Pay

Based on available data, the average student at Tyler Junior College pays approximately $9,924 per year after grants and aid. This is below the Texas average of $17,343 and below the national average of $17,506.

Financial Aid

About 35.62% of Tyler Junior College students receive federal Pell grants, indicating the share of students receiving this need-based aid in the local dataset. 20.01% take federal loans, which helps families understand borrowing patterns alongside net price.

Accreditation

Tyler Junior College lists Southern Association of Colleges and Schools Commission on Colleges as its accreditor in the local dataset. Institutional accreditation is an important trust signal and can affect federal financial aid eligibility. Accreditation means an external agency has reviewed academic quality and institutional standards, which helps families verify whether federal aid pathways such as Pell grants and federal loans may apply.
